Abba star Bjorn Ulvaeus said the pop group will never perform again because it would be "too enormous" - as he unveiled a show charting the rise of the band against the backdrop of "grim" 1970s Britain.

The immersive exhibition at London's Southbank Centre takes visitors inside a dark and dreary British living room, a recreation of the Brighton hotel bedrooms the band slept in following their stunning Eurovision win, a recording studio and an aeroplane cabin.

Ulvaeus (72) said the exhibition made him realise how "impossibly gloomy" Britain was at the time, with a collapsing economy, a three-day working week, and strikes.
